W

wp-block-themes

작성자 WordPress

WordPress 블록 테마 작업에 wp-block-themes를 사용하세요: theme.json, 템플릿, 템플릿 파트, 패턴, 스타일 변형, Site Editor 디버깅까지 다룹니다. 디자인 구현, 설치 및 사용 흐름, 그리고 스타일 계층, 오버라이드, 캐싱, 사용자 맞춤 설정 문제를 적은 추측으로 해결하도록 설계되어 있습니다.

Stars0
즐겨찾기0
댓글0
추가됨2026년 5월 8일
카테고리Design Implementation
설치 명령어
npx skills add WordPress/agent-skills --skill wp-block-themes
큐레이션 점수

이 스킬의 점수는 84/100으로, WordPress 블록 테마 작업을 집중적으로 지원하는 도구를 찾는 디렉터리 사용자에게 적합한 후보입니다. 트리거 인식이 잘 되고 작업 흐름도 명확하며, theme.json, 템플릿, 템플릿 파트, 패턴, 스타일 변형, 디버깅을 일반적인 프롬프트보다 훨씬 적은 추측으로 처리할 수 있도록 충분한 구조를 제공합니다.

84/100
강점
  • 강력한 사용 사례 트리거: theme.json, 템플릿, 패턴, 스타일 변형, Site Editor 문제 해결을 포함해 블록 테마 개발을 명확히 겨냥합니다.
  • 실행 정보가 탄탄함: 필요한 입력과 단계별 절차가 구체적인 명령어, 번들된 감지 스크립트와 함께 제시됩니다.
  • 참고 자료의 깊이가 좋음: 테마 만들기, 디버깅, 템플릿/파트, 패턴, 스타일 변형, theme.json 동작을 다루는 보조 문서가 여러 개 포함됩니다.
주의점
  • SKILL.md에 설치 명령이 없어서, 사용자가 자신의 에이전트 환경에 직접 연결해야 할 수 있습니다.
  • 이 발췌본은 WordPress 6.9+와 파일시스템 기반 워크플로에 특화되어 있어, 범용 WordPress 스킬로 보기에는 범위가 좁습니다.
개요

wp-block-themes 스킬 개요

wp-block-themes가 다루는 범위

wp-block-themes 스킬은 WordPress 블록 테마 작업에 도움을 줍니다. theme.json, 템플릿, 템플릿 파트, 패턴, 스타일 변형, 그리고 흔히 겪는 “왜 스타일이 안 보이지?” 디버깅 흐름까지 포함합니다. 블록 테마에 대해 막연하게 묻는 대신, 파일 시스템을 이해하는 WordPress 전용 워크플로가 필요할 때 가장 유용합니다.

누가 사용하면 좋은가

블록 테마를 구현하거나 유지보수하는 경우, 클래식 테마를 블록 테마로 전환하는 경우, 또는 Site Editor 동작을 점검해야 하는 경우에 wp-block-themes 스킬을 사용하세요. 프런트엔드, 편집기, 사용자가 커스터마이즈한 스타일 전반에서 예측 가능한 결과가 필요한 디자인 구현 작업에 잘 맞습니다.

무엇이 다른가

이 스킬은 의사결정 중심입니다. 무엇부터 확인해야 하는지, 어떤 파일이 중요한지, WordPress가 테마 설정과 사용자 오버라이드를 어떻게 해석하는지 알려줍니다. 그래서 “블록 테마를 도와줘”라고만 모델에 요청하는 것보다 훨씬 실용적입니다. 범위, 호환성, 변경 위치에 대한 추측을 줄여주기 때문입니다.

wp-block-themes 스킬 사용 방법

올바르게 설치하고 범위를 정하기

다음 명령으로 설치합니다:
npx skills add WordPress/agent-skills --skill wp-block-themes

wp-block-themes의 설치와 설정에서는, 무엇을 바꾸기 전에 먼저 활성 테마의 루트 범위를 정확히 잡아야 합니다. 저장소에 테마가 여러 개 들어 있다면 정확한 테마 디렉터리와 대상 WordPress 버전을 먼저 확인하세요. theme.json 기능과 동작은 코어 버전에 따라 달라질 수 있습니다.

스킬에 올바른 입력을 주기

wp-block-themes 사용 패턴은 다음 정보를 분명히 줄 때 가장 잘 작동합니다:

  • 테마 루트 또는 repo 루트
  • 정확한 대상 영역: theme.json, templates/, parts/, patterns/, 또는 styles/
  • 문제가 나타나는 위치: Site Editor, 글 편집기, 프런트엔드, 또는 셋 다
  • 새로 만드는 작업인지, 변환 작업인지, 디버깅인지

좋은 프롬프트 예시는 다음과 같습니다: “활성 블록 테마의 theme.json을 수정해서 버튼이 편집기와 프런트엔드 모두에서 새 브랜드 색상을 쓰도록 해주세요. 다만 사용자 오버라이드는 유지하세요. 대상은 WordPress 6.9입니다. 필요하면 template parts도 확인해 주세요.”

먼저 읽어야 할 파일

먼저 SKILL.md를 읽고, 이어서 아래 파일들을 확인하세요:

  • references/theme-json.md
  • references/templates-and-parts.md
  • references/patterns.md
  • references/style-variations.md
  • references/debugging.md
  • references/creating-new-block-theme.md

저장소 구조가 불명확하다면 scripts/detect_block_themes.mjs도 확인하세요. wp-block-themes 가이드는 편집 전에 탐지 단계를 먼저 따를 때 가장 강합니다.

올바른 순서로 작업하기

실용적인 작업 순서는 다음과 같습니다:

  1. 테마 루트 탐지
  2. 문제가 나타나는 표면 확인
  3. 관련 reference 파일 검토
  4. 동작을 소유해야 할 가장 작은 파일 수정
  5. 사용자 커스터마이즈와 캐시된 편집기 상태를 기준으로 테스트

이 순서가 중요한 이유는, “깨졌다”고 보이는 블록 테마 문제가 실제로는 잘못된 테마 파일이 아니라 스타일 계층 구조나 저장된 사용자 설정 문제인 경우가 많기 때문입니다.

wp-block-themes 스킬 FAQ

wp-block-themes는 고급 사용자만 쓰는 건가요?

아닙니다. 어떤 테마를 편집하는지 알고 있고, 바꾸려는 대상도 분명히 설명할 수 있다면 초보자에게도 충분히 친화적입니다. 이 스킬이 WordPress 특유의 경로와 판단을 처리해 주지만, 테마 맥락과 원하는 결과는 여전히 사용자가 제공해야 합니다.

언제는 쓰지 말아야 하나요?

일반적인 WordPress 플러그인 작업, 블록 테마 바깥의 PHP 템플릿 계층 디버깅, 또는 테마 파일을 건드리지 않는 시각 디자인 작업에는 wp-block-themes를 쓰지 마세요. 문제가 테마, 사용자 커스터마이즈, Site Editor 중 어디에 있는지 전혀 모를 때도 최적의 선택은 아닙니다.

일반 프롬프트와 뭐가 다른가요?

일반 프롬프트는 테마 파일 시스템, 호환 범위, 블록 테마 파일 위치를 확인하지 않은 채 변경을 제안할 수 있습니다. wp-block-themes 스킬은 theme.json, 템플릿, parts, styles 전반에서 체계적으로 wp-block-themes usage를 적용해야 할 때 더 강합니다. 특히 정확한 파일 배치가 중요한 디자인 구현 작업에서 차이가 큽니다.

도입을 막는 가장 흔한 이유는 무엇인가요?

가장 흔한 장애물은 테마 범위가 불명확한 것, WordPress 버전 목표가 빠진 것, 그리고 테마 기본값과 사용자가 선택한 스타일을 혼동하는 것입니다. 이런 정보를 미리 답할 수 없더라도 스킬이 완전히 무력해지는 것은 아니지만, 첫 결과의 정확도는 떨어질 수 있습니다.

wp-block-themes 스킬 개선 방법

디자인 입력을 더 구체적으로 주기

디자인 구현용 wp-block-themes 결과를 더 좋게 만들려면, 정확한 디자인 의도와 영향을 받는 블록 또는 영역을 제공하세요. 예를 들어 “테마를 더 깔끔하게 해주세요”보다 “모든 템플릿에서 기본 heading 간격과 button radius를 설정해 주세요”라고 말하는 편이 훨씬 좋습니다. 전자는 실행 가능한 지시이지만, 후자는 모델이 요구사항을 추측하게 만듭니다.

기본값과 오버라이드를 분리해서 말하기

흔한 실패 패턴 중 하나는 theme.json 변경이 사용자 커스터마이즈까지 덮어쓸 거라고 기대하는 것입니다. 실제 문제가 저장된 global styles나 선택된 style variation에 있다면 그 사실을 함께 알려야 합니다. 결과를 개선하려면 원하는 것이 다음 중 무엇인지 분명히 적으세요:

  • 테마 기본값
  • 편집기 컨트롤
  • 스타일 변형
  • 단일 템플릿 변경

가장 작은 실패 예제로 반복하기

첫 결과가 거의 맞지만 완전히 맞지는 않는다면, 다음 요청에서는 파일 하나와 증상 하나만 남기고 좁히세요. 예를 들어: “styles/blue.json이 선택되지만 새로고침 후 반영되지 않습니다. 이것이 예상 동작인지, 무엇을 테스트해야 하는지 설명해 주세요.” 이런 식의 요청이 넓은 재설계보다 훨씬 나은 디버깅 결과를 만듭니다.

저장소 규칙에 맞는지 검증하기

wp-block-themes 스킬은 편집 전에 저장소가 patterns, style variations, 또는 최소 테마 스캐폴드를 사용하는지 확인할 때 더 잘 작동합니다. 첫 결과가 너무 일반적으로 느껴진다면, repo 파일 경로, 활성 테마 이름, 그리고 적용하고 싶은 정확한 reference 파일을 함께 넣어 다시 실행하세요.

평점 및 리뷰

아직 평점이 없습니다
리뷰 남기기
이 스킬의 평점과 리뷰를 남기려면 로그인하세요.
G
0/10000
최신 리뷰
저장 중...